WebDRAXXIN Injectable Solution is a ready-to-use sterile parenteral preparation containing tulathromycin, a semi-synthetic macrolide antibiotic of the subclass triamilide. Each mL of DRAXXIN contains 100 mg of tulathromycin as the free base in a 50% propylene glycol vehicle, monothioglycerol (5 mg/mL), with citric and hydrochloric acids added to ... Contains active ingredient Tulathromycin. Relatively short withdrawal period for both cattle and swine. Single dose provides upto 14 days of treatment/control for Bovine Respiratory Disease. Recommended dosage of Draxxin ® is 2.5 mg per kg (1.1 ml per 100 lbs). Injected subcutaneously into neck. mckissick v. carmichael

WebAug 24, 2024 · Short meat withdrawal of 18 days; Draxxin KP has the same dose size and viscosity as Draxxin, so you should expect the same year-round syringeability as Draxxin. ... Draxxin has a pre-slaughter withdrawal time of 18 days in cattle. Do not use in female dairy cattle 20 months of age or older. WebImportant Safety Information for Cattle: Do not use in female dairy cattle 20 months of age or older. Do not use in calves to be processed for veal. ... DRAXXIN has a pre-slaughter withdrawal time of 18 days. DRAXXIN should not be used in animals known to be hypersensitive to the product.
